Plumbing costs change based on the complexity of the repair and the accessibility of the pipes. If a pro needs to cut into drywall or dig underground to reach a leak, the labor time increases. Older homes sometimes require updating outdated materials, like galvanized steel, to meet current codes. The timing of the service also matters, as after-hours or holiday calls often carry different rates than standard business hours. While simple drain clearings or fixture swaps are usually on the lower end, larger system repipes cost more.
Eco plumbers focus on sustainable water solutions, such as installing low-flow fixtures, tankless water heaters, and greywater recycling systems. You should contact them if you want to lower your monthly utility bills or reduce your household water waste.
